U.S. Son on Malaysia Flight

by Cheryl · In: Blog, Comfort, Encouragement · on Mar 19, 2014

News Video: Grieving US Mother Clings To God Grievous disappearance How does a mother respond when crisis strikes? Sondra Wood had just seen her son, Philip, the week before he disappeared on the Malaysian aircraft, flight 370. Philip had visited her Texas home and shared about his IBM job-move from Beijing to Malaysia. “He was excited about his new adventure,” says the devastated mother. “Only people who know God can survive things like this in a good way. I know in my heart I will get through this.” As a Christian, Sondra knows God doesn’t spare us from trouble. He does, however, …
